Music Scholars Education Program

This program is open, by audition, to high school freshmen, sophomores, juniors, and seniors in the counties of Bucks, Montgomery, and Philadelphia. It fosters a student's music education, gives them an opportunity to grow as young musicians, explore repertoire and performing opportunities they would not normally be exposed to, and allows for collaboration with the artistic staff and current members of MCCO. The Scholars Program is open to vocalists and string players.
